Getty Images A frail Harvey Weinstein was wheeled into a New York City courtroom on Tuesday morning to face his fourth rape trial in six years.
Weinstein is accused in this case of assaulting Jessica Mann, who has testified at two previous trials that the producer raped her at a Manhattan hotel room in March 2013.
Weinstein was convicted of the third-degree rape of Mann in 2020, but that verdict was overturned by the state’s highest court. At a retrial last summer, jurors found Weinstein guilty of assaulting another victim, Miriam Haley, but deadlocked on the charge relating to Mann, forcing prosecutors to try the charge for a third time.
